Responsibilities

  • Maintain enterprise applications using Java and Spring Boot.
  • Build scalable and secure APIs and microservices as needed.
  • Develop cloud-native applications using AWS services and design highly available, fault-tolerant AWS solutions.
  • Work with relational and NoSQL databases to optimize queries and application performance.
  • Understand containerized applications and deploy them using Kubernetes/EKS or ECS.
  • Implement C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ins, GitHub Actions, or AWS CodePipeline.
  • Apply application security practices using OAuth2, JWT, IAM, and secure coding.
  • Write unit, integration, and automated tests using JUnit, Mockito, and related frameworks.
  • Troubleshoot production issues, perform root-cause analysis, improve reliability, and support incident and release readiness processes.
  • Collaborate with architects, product managers, QA, DevOps, and other engineering teams while contributing to code reviews and engineering standards.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or engineering, or equivalent professional experience.
  • At least 5 years of hands-on AWS experience.
  • At least 2 years of Salesforce platform experience.
  • At least 2 years of experience working with SAP services in an enterprise environment.
  • Strong understanding of enterprise application architecture, integrations, data flows, logs, system metrics, and transactional data analysis.
  • Experience in ITIL-aligned or incident/problem management environments.
  • Experience developing, troubleshooting, writing, reviewing, or debugging Java-based applications or services.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ines, version control, automated deployments, monitoring, logging, and alerting tools.
  • Strong communication, prioritization, analytical problem-solving, adaptability, and attention to detail.
  • Ability to support critical activities outside normal business hours when required.

Autodesk is changing how the world is designed and made. Our technology spans architecture, engineering, construction, product design, manufacturing, and media and entertainment. We empower innovators everywhere to solve challenges, big and small. From greener buildings to smarter products and more mesmerizing blockbusters, Autodesk software helps our customers design and make a better world for all. Over 100 million people use Autodesk software, like AutoCAD, Revit, Maya, 3ds Max, Fusion 360, SketchBook, and more, to unlock their creativity and solve important design, business, and environmental challenges. Our software runs on both personal computers and mobile devices. It taps the infinite computing power of the cloud to help teams around the world collaborate, design, simulate, and fabricate their ideas in 3D.
